Factors Influencing Shipping Costs
Several factors can affect the overall cost of shipping a car from the UK to the USA:
- Shipping Method: The two primary methods are container shipping and roll-on/roll-off (RoRo) shipping. Container shipping is generally more expensive but offers better protection for the vehicle.
- Vehicle Size and Weight: Larger and heavier vehicles typically incur higher shipping costs due to space and weight restrictions.
- Distance and Destination Port: The distance from the UK port to the destination port in the USA can influence shipping rates. Major ports like Los Angeles or New York may have different rates compared to smaller ports.
- Insurance: Opting for insurance coverage during shipping can add to the overall cost but provides peace of mind.
- Customs and Duties: Import duties and taxes may apply when bringing a vehicle into the USA, which can significantly increase the total cost.
Shipping Methods Explained
Understanding the different shipping methods can help you choose the best option for your needs:
- Container Shipping: This method involves placing your vehicle in a shipping container, providing maximum protection. It is ideal for high-value or classic cars but can be more expensive, typically ranging from $2,000 to $3,500.
- Roll-on/Roll-off (RoRo) Shipping: In this method, the vehicle is driven onto the ship and secured in place. It is generally cheaper, with costs ranging from $1,000 to $1,500, but offers less protection against the elements.

How the Shipping Process Works
The process of shipping a car from the UK to the USA can be broken down into several key steps:
- Research and Choose a Shipping Company: Start by researching reputable shipping companies that specialize in international car shipping. Look for reviews and testimonials to gauge their reliability.
- Get Quotes: Contact multiple shipping companies to obtain quotes. Provide details about your vehicle, including make, model, and dimensions, to get accurate estimates.
- Select a Shipping Method: Decide between container shipping and RoRo shipping based on your budget and the level of protection you desire for your vehicle.
- Prepare Your Vehicle: Clean your car, remove personal items, and ensure it is in good working condition. Take photos for documentation.
- Complete Necessary Paperwork: Fill out all required forms, including customs declarations and shipping contracts. Ensure you have the vehicle’s title and registration.
- Drop Off or Arrange Pickup: Depending on the shipping company, either drop off your vehicle at the designated port or arrange for it to be picked up.
- Track Your Shipment: Most shipping companies provide tracking services, allowing you to monitor the status of your vehicle during transit.
- Customs Clearance: Upon arrival in the USA, your vehicle will go through customs. Be prepared to pay any applicable duties and taxes.
- Pick Up Your Vehicle: Once cleared, you can either pick up your vehicle from the port or have it delivered to your specified location.
Main Factors Affecting Shipping Outcomes
Several factors can significantly influence the cost, time, and overall experience of shipping a car from the UK to the USA:
| Factor | Description | Impact on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Shipping Method | Container shipping offers more protection than RoRo shipping but is more expensive. | Container: $2,000 – $3,500; RoRo: $1,000 – $1,500 |
| Vehicle Size and Weight | Larger and heavier vehicles require more space and resources, increasing shipping costs. | Varies based on vehicle specifications |
| Distance and Destination Port | The distance from the UK port to the destination port in the USA can affect shipping rates. | Major ports may have lower rates due to higher traffic |
| Insurance | Opting for insurance coverage during shipping adds to the overall cost but protects your investment. | Typically 1-2% of the vehicle’s value |
| Customs and Duties | Import duties and taxes can significantly increase the total cost of shipping a vehicle. | Varies based on vehicle value and type |
Examples of Cost Variations
To illustrate how these factors can affect shipping costs, consider the following examples:
- Example 1: A standard sedan shipped via RoRo from Southampton to New York may cost around $1,200, while the same vehicle shipped in a container could cost $2,800.
- Example 2: A luxury SUV weighing over 5,000 pounds may incur additional fees due to its size, potentially raising the total shipping cost to $3,500 when using container shipping.
- Example 3: A classic car valued at $30,000 shipped with insurance coverage may add an extra $600 to the overall cost due to insurance fees.
Time Considerations
The time it takes to ship a car from the UK to the USA can vary based on several factors:
- Shipping Method: RoRo shipping typically takes 2-4 weeks, while container shipping may take 4-6 weeks due to additional handling.
- Customs Clearance: The time required for customs clearance can vary, often taking a few days to a week, depending on documentation and inspections.
- Port Congestion: Busy ports may experience delays, impacting the overall shipping timeline.

1. Unexpected Costs
One of the most common issues is encountering unexpected costs that were not included in the initial quote. These can include customs duties, port fees, and insurance costs.
How to Avoid This Problem
- Request Detailed Quotes: Always ask for a breakdown of costs when obtaining quotes from shipping companies. This should include all potential fees.
- Research Customs Duties: Familiarize yourself with the customs duties and taxes applicable to your vehicle. The U.S. Customs and Border Protection website provides valuable information.
- Consider Insurance: Factor in the cost of insurance when budgeting for shipping. It’s often worth the investment for peace of mind.
2. Delays in Shipping
Delays can occur due to various reasons, including port congestion, bad weather, or issues with customs clearance. These delays can disrupt your plans and lead to additional costs.
How to Avoid This Problem
- Plan Ahead: Start the shipping process well in advance of your intended timeline. This allows for unexpected delays.
- Choose Off-Peak Times: If possible, avoid shipping during peak seasons when ports are busier, such as summer months or holidays.
- Stay Informed: Regularly check in with your shipping company for updates on your shipment status.
3. Incomplete Documentation
Missing or incorrect documentation can lead to significant delays and complications during the shipping process. This is a common issue that can be easily avoided with proper preparation.
How to Avoid This Problem
- Check Requirements: Research the documentation required for shipping a vehicle to the USA, including the vehicle title, registration, and customs forms.
- Double-Check Everything: Before submitting any paperwork, review it for accuracy and completeness. Consider having a professional review it if you’re unsure.
- Keep Copies: Always keep copies of all documents submitted and received for your records.
4. Choosing the Wrong Shipping Method
Many individuals are unsure whether to choose container shipping or RoRo shipping, leading to potential issues with vehicle protection and costs.
How to Avoid This Problem
- Assess Your Vehicle’s Value: If you are shipping a high-value or classic car, opt for container shipping for better protection.
- Understand Your Needs: Consider how quickly you need the vehicle and your budget. RoRo is generally cheaper but offers less protection.
- Consult Professionals: Seek advice from shipping experts who can guide you on the best method based on your specific situation.
5. Lack of Insurance Coverage
Many people underestimate the importance of insurance when shipping a vehicle, which can lead to significant financial loss in case of damage or loss during transit.
How to Avoid This Problem
- Always Insure Your Vehicle: Opt for insurance coverage that protects your vehicle during transit. This is especially important for high-value cars.
- Understand the Policy: Read the insurance policy carefully to know what is covered and any exclusions that may apply.
- Consider Additional Coverage: If your vehicle is particularly valuable, consider additional coverage beyond the standard policy.
